Fes: The Trip to the Souk

An experience for all five senses…

Grocery shopping in Morocco is very far from the supermarkets with freezer-wrapped packages in the West. Although a few chain supermarkets have made their entrance into some of the bigger cities in Morocco, most Moroccans continue to do their shopping in the souks, where they know that they can get fresh ingredients (for cheaper, too!). Since very few Moroccan families living in the Medina own a refrigerator, most people go to the souk every day to buy their groceries for the day’s home-cooked meal, which is most commonly either a tagine or couscous. They make the rounds to the different vendors to pick up all of the necessary ingredients.
